Summary of Area/Department Focus
Operations are responsible for the delivery of infrastructure and service delivery. The prime focus of Central Services is to manage all core inbound/outbound support services, as well as the property portfolio, facilities and health and safety. A key requirement is for the team to work together to deliver the highest quality of service.

Summary of Job Purpose
This role assists in the delivery of print, support and postal services to a nationwide network of offices with a total user community of 250 staff.

The primary responsibility of this role is to work as part of the Central Services Team within the Operations function. This team provides the day to day delivery of all central printing and postal services, other workstreams and project duties where necessary.

Key Accountabilities

  • To deliver all aspects of central print services in line with agreed standards and
  • To deliver all aspects of inbound and outbound post services, this includes correct classification and allocation of post documents and providing excellent service to customers.
  • To deliver client related administrative tasks including producing valuations and completing client checks.
  • To take part in delivery of projects where necessary, this includes central mailings and FCA-related tasks.
  • To provide reception services as necessary, this includes the management of Central Services mailbox and other duties.
  • To undertake heavy lifting of paperwork on an ad-hoc, restocking basis.
  • To undertake ad-hoc duties and workstreams as necessary within the Operations function.
